Hardcover (5-6" by 8-9") Flat signed by Frank Herbert on the full title page. Later printing, probably a 5th printing but may be a 6th or 7th To our knowledge there is no way to determine which of these three printings a copy of this edition represents. Red cloth boards (which means it is not a 1st printing as the 1st through 4th printings had blue boards) and DJ marked with $7.95 price (the 8th printing and later had a dj price of $10.95.) The number line on the copyright page reads 67890 43210987. NOT a bookclub edition. Complete run of 11 issues. Large pulp magazine. 96 pages each. Privately collected, trimmed and bound in light green buckram. The third science fiction magazine published by Gernsback (after AMAZING STORIES and SCIENCE WONDER STORIES, combined with the later in 1930 as WONDER STORIES.) Covers by Frank R. Paul. A very scarce and fragile issue, primarily notable for containing the first appearance of Howard's "The Garden of Fear," the first story in the James Allison series. This second issue of the short-lived Marvel Tales series, published by William L. Crawford (who also owned a printing press) had 3 variant covers - in different colors and on different paper ... An important anthology containing 33 original stories, at the time the largest anthology ever published of all original stories of speculative fiction. Each selection is preceded by an introduction by Ellison and followed with an Afterword by the author. SIGNED by THREE authors at their stories: Robert Silverberg at "Flies;" Frederik Pohl at "The Day After the Day After the Martians Came" and Larry Niven at "The Jigsaw Man." In addition to the contributors shown above, this includes works by Philip Jose Farmer, Norman Spinrad, Howard Rodman, Lester Del Rey, J. G. Ballard, Robert Bloch, David Bunch, Damon Knight, Joe L. Hensley and many more. Illustrations by Diane and Leo Dillon. 544 pages.
